  13. HTC One S

    Meet one of the latest Android based smart phones in the market. The HTC One S available from Tmobile. The HTC One S is the thinnest phone ever made by HTC, and they didn&rsquo;t skimp on design. It is made out of a single piece of aluminum, and features a 4.3 inch display. Big enough to check emails and browse, but not so big that you can&rsquo;t hold it properly in order to make a call.&nbsp; Aside from its good looks, this phone packs a punch. The HTC One S runs a dual-core 1.5 GHz Qualcomm Snapdragon S4 processor. In other words, if you like playing games on your phone or multi tasking with apps, you won&rsquo;t be disappointed.&nbsp; The HTC One S also comes standard with a Beats by Dre audio system. With headphones the sound is richer, but the regular speakers don&rsquo;t pack the same punch.
